Submitting patient documents in Ideagen Maritime Health Provider

This guide provides instructions for submitting patient documents in the Ideagen Maritime Health Provider application. Following a patient's appointment at the clinic, which may include an examination or referral, the clinical user is responsible for submitting the necessary documents for review and incorporation into the patient's chart.
1. Submitting a document
To submit a document:
- Locate the patient in the Workflow list.
- Click the Upload button.

- Under the Details tab, select the Document Type.
- Choose the correct Vessel to save it to.
- Add Comments as needed.

- Switch to the Files tab.
- Specify the Document name.
- Upload the document.
- Use the Upload option under to upload the document that you are sending.
- Use the Existing option to attach a document that was previously uploaded for the patient.
- Use the Preview button to review the document.

- Click Submit.

A confirmation message will appear if the submission has been completed successfully.

2. Viewing a document status
To view updates, select the Paperclip to open the documents window again. Under the Document Status column, the document will be displayed as the Submitted status.

To track document updates and change in statuses, check the Document Status for:

- Submitted (blue) - Indicates that the document has been shared by the Provider.
- Received (orange) - Indicating that it has been received by the recipient.
- Accepted (green) - Indicating that it has been reviewed and accepted by the company.
- Rejected (red) - Indicating that the document was rejected and returned to your workflow.
